Bascom Forest, San Jose,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bascom Forest?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bascom Forest Studio Apartments | $2,723 | $972 | $3,697 |
| Bascom Forest 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,346 | $1,036 | $5,291 |
| Bascom Forest 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,283 | $1,233 | $10,000+ |
| Bascom Forest 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,730 | $1,460 | $9,255 |
| Bascom Forest 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,627 | $4,077 | $5,177 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Corporate Bascom Forest Apartments
What is the Cheapest Corporate apartment in Bascom Forest?
Currently the most affordable Corporate Apartment in Bascom Forest is at eaves West Valley listed at $1,980.
How much is the average rent for a Corporate Bascom Forest Apartment?
The average rent for a Corporate Apartment in Bascom Forest is $4,778.
What is the largest Corporate Bascom Forest Apartment for rent?
Today's Corporate apartment with the most square footage in Bascom Forest is a 2,900 square feet unit starting from $3,347 at Santana Row.
What is the average size for Bascom Forest Corporate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Corporate rental in Bascom Forest is currently at 583 sq ft.
